Choosing a Sliding Compound Miter Saw vs. an Circular Saw for Cutting Aluminium

When it comes to shaping aluminium profiles, the decision between a compound miter saw and an radial arm saw is critical . Miter saws generally give greater precision for angled cuts, making them perfect for molding work and intricate projects. However, upcut saws, particularly those with a high-tooth count blade, can perform exceptionally well, minimizing burring and producing a cleaner edge, especially on heavier aluminium stock. Finally, the preferred tool depends on the type of work you perform .

  • Advantages of a Sliding Compound Miter Saw: Precision , Angled cuts.
  • Advantages of an Upcut Saw: Limited burring, Smoother edge.

Selecting the Ideal Miter Tool for Alu Pieces

When working with alu for crafts, selecting the right miter machine is vital. Compared to wood, aluminum can easily clog blades, so a high-quality blade designed here for metal materials is very important. Consider a battery-powered model for greater maneuverability or a benchtop saw for extensive uses. Furthermore, look for options like blade velocity control and a material capture system to keep a tidy workspace.

Rising Saw Benefits for Alloy Machine Operations

Utilizing a rising saw offers key gains in alloy machine operations . The saw's upward material removal action dramatically minimizes the tendency of debris buildup in the kerf , a common challenge when machining alloy . This provides a better cut, reduced tool fatigue , and improved workpiece finish , ultimately boosting productivity in your workshop .

Knowing Miter Device Abilities using Aluminum

Working with aluminum and a miter saw requires knowing its unique limits . Aluminum's less dense nature indicates it will be susceptible to chipping if improperly processed. As a result, applying the correct cutting disc – typically a specialized tool designed to non-ferrous alloys – is critical . In addition, lowering the operational pace and utilizing controlled techniques are necessary to produce precise cuts .
